Ather Energy Rolls Out Pothole+ Alerts for Gen 2 Scooters

The feature uses anonymised telemetry from Ather’s connected scooters to warn riders about potholes and other road hazards before they reach them.

Overview

  • Ather announced the rollout this week and has begun delivering Pothole+ Alerts to Gen 2 and newer scooters including the 450 Apex, 450X and Rizta Z.
  • The system flags potholes, broken road patches, uneven surfaces and speed breakers and shows a visual warning on the scooter dashboard.
  • Riders can also hear audio alerts through the scooter’s speakers, the Ather Halo smart helmet or any compatible Bluetooth headset to avoid taking their eyes off the road.
  • Ather says the feature was built from nearly nine years of anonymised fleet data and on-scooter compute and is offered via a software update, though independent performance or geographic coverage details were not provided.
  • The launch highlights a shift to software-led safety upgrades for connected vehicles and could reduce surprise hazards on common routes as the company grows its road-condition dataset.
